namespace qpid {
namespace cluster {

// FIXME aconway 2008-09-15: rename cluster status?

/**
 * Map of established cluster members and brain-dumps in progress.
 * A dumper is an established member that is sending catch-up data.
 * A dumpee is an aspiring member that is receiving catch-up data.
 */
class ClusterMap {
  public:
    typedef std::map<MemberId, Url> Members;
    Members members;
    MemberId dumper;

    ClusterMap();
    
    /** First member of the cluster in ID order, gets to perform one-off tasks. */
    MemberId first() const;

    /** Update for members leaving. */
    void left(const cpg_address* addrs, size_t size);

    /** Convert map contents to a cluster update body. */
    framing::ClusterUpdateBody toControl() const;

    /** Add a new member. */
    void add(const MemberId& id, const Url& url);

    /** Apply update delivered from clsuter. */
    void update(const framing::FieldTable& members, uint64_t dumper);

    bool isMember(const MemberId& id) const { return members.find(id) != members.end(); }

    bool sendUpdate(const MemberId& id) const; // True if id should send an update.
    std::vector<Url> memberUrls() const;
    size_t size() const { return members.size(); }
    
  private:

  friend std::ostream& operator<<(std::ostream&, const ClusterMap&);
  friend std::ostream& operator<<(std::ostream& o, const ClusterMap::Members::value_type& mv);
};

}} // namespace qpid::cluster
